Radio button z polami z różnych kolumn

Witam!

Próbuję zrobić wyszukiwarkę telefonów komórkowych opartą na ankiecie. Admin będzie tworzył odpowiedzi do ankiety do każdego telefonu. Model bazy będzie wyglądać na tej zasadzie: dziecko, nastolatek, dorosły, dobry wzrok, zły wzrok, kobieta, mężczyzna itp. i każde pole będzie mogło mieć wartość true/false. Tworzenie ankiety przez admina będzie odbywało się przez zaznaczanie checkboxów (np. telefon będzie mógł mieć true dla dziecko i nastolatek), ale już wyszukiwanie przez użytkownika chciałabym zrobić za pomocą radio buttonów (żeby do wyboru była możliwa tylko jedna odpowiedź z danej kategorii). I tutaj pojawia się problem, bo nie wiem jak zrobić radio, które obejmowałoby np. pola kobieta, mężczyzna, które są z dwóch różnych kolumn i po wyborze któregoś na to pole ustawia true (normalnie radio bierze jedną kolumnę i ustawia w niej jedną z podanych wartości).

Mam nadzieję, że w miarę zrozumiale opisałam mój problem i że ktoś zna jakieś rozwiązanie :slight_smile:

musiał byś sobie zorbic virtualne pole np km typu boolean np i przyjac w nim ze true to mezczyna np a false kobieta, i wtedy w before filter przypisac odpowiednie wartosci kobiecie, mezczyznie na podstawie tego virtualnego pola. Mozna inaczej tez oczywiscie, ale mam nadzieje ze idee łapiesz

A może zamiast zrobić dziecko, nastolatek itd, zrobić np: przeznaczenie i 1 -> dziecko, 2 -> nastolatek itd.
Jak dojdzie młodzieniec w podeszłym wieku to dodanie go nie będzie problemem i wtedy radio będzie działać bez problemu.

Pozdro